Output fe590937a3329452f97018f76e28ab3aaac77ec95cf53a96c308ae50c46a8088:3

value
434737029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d282e9304d68d42525dcb6bc46a3fd4e27990f19 OP_EQUAL
address
3Lt6egBtkeeD4Ybs5KBp2MFDvnHv7c1BQr
transaction
fe590937a3329452f97018f76e28ab3aaac77ec95cf53a96c308ae50c46a8088
spent
true